The Drafter is responsible for completing specifically assigned drafting projects as assigned by the Product Development Manager.
Essential Duties & Responsibilities
Develops accurate and complete production drawings, bills of material and/or tooled parts layout, and vendor drawings for assigned models and/or projects
Coordinates the drawings and bills of material with other Drafters involved in common projects to ensure the project is completed in a timely manner.
Keeps abreast of current Drafting Standards to maintain continuity during the drawing and bill of material development process.
Maintains the library of production drawings and bills of material to ensure a central source of current reference information is available and accessible to all departments.
Perform other duties as assigned.
Minimum Qualifications
High School Diploma with Drafting Fundamentals exposure
One or more years of manufacturing assembly experience or one or more years of drafting experience
Strong computer skills and understanding of relevant software packages
Strong mechanical skills
Motivated self-starter with a strong tolerance for change
